The car logo would need to incorporate elements that are associated with automobiles, such as speed, movement, or sleek design.
The restaurant logo would need to convey the type of cuisine or ambiance of the establishment, using food-related visuals and possibly incorporating utensils, dishes, or culinary icons.
The car logo would potentially need to work well on a larger scale, such as on the front grill or side of a vehicle, while the restaurant logo may be mostly used in smaller sizes, like on menus or social media profiles.
The car logo would need to appeal to a wider and more diverse audience, considering the varied demographics and interests of potential car buyers. The restaurant logo, on the other hand, would primarily target a localized audience or specific community.
Overall, the design principles for both logos would vary to accommodate the unique characteristics, objectives, and target audience of each industry.
